Israel navy arrests Greta Thunberg, activists group during Gaza aid delivery attempt

Swedish activist Greta Thunberg is among those who were arrested Sunday, as they attempted to sail humanitarian aid through an Israeli naval blockade, all in an attempt to feed and clothe those in the Gaza strip.
It was around 2 am local time that those on board the ship began sending out distress calls, taking to telegram and sharing that they had “come under attack.”
Their last transmission was from a livestream of them inside the ships helm, mere moments before they were taken into custody.
The latest update from Israeli authorities indicates that those who were detained at sea, are still in transit and on their way to an Israeli port.
The nation’s foreign ministry maintains that it intends to deport them, soon after they land.
